By shifting the emphasis of GCE History firmly to the 'why' and 'how', alongside the more traditional 'what', of the historian's work, this brand new specification represents a distinct and exciting development in the study of history at AS/A Level. It encourages candidates to explore the theory and methodology of history through the study of four aspects of the subject: theories of explanation and the use and limitations of source materials at AS, and of interpretations and of historical significance at A2. This approach forms a strong foundation for the study of history at a higher level.
